The primary reason why do RV refrigerators catch fire boils down to a combination of factors, most notably the unique operating principles of RV refrigerators, the demanding environment in which they function, and the potential for component wear and tear. Unlike your standard household refrigerator that uses an electric compressor, most RV refrigerators rely on a process called absorption cooling. This method uses heat, typically generated by propane (LP gas) or electricity, to circulate a mixture of ammonia, water, and hydrogen. While highly effective and energy-efficient for off-grid living, this heat-driven system introduces more potential points of failure and, consequently, a greater risk of fire if not properly maintained or if components malfunction.

Common Culprits: The Specific Reasons RV Refrigerators Catch Fire
Now that we have a basic understanding of the system, let's pinpoint the most common reasons why do RV refrigerators catch fire:
1. Propane Burner System MalfunctionsThe propane burner is the most frequent culprit when it comes to RV refrigerator fires. This system is directly responsible for generating the heat needed for the absorption cycle. Here are the specific issues that can arise:
Soot Buildup: Incomplete combustion of propane can lead to soot and carbon buildup within the burner assembly and flue. This buildup can restrict airflow, leading to inefficient burning and, more critically, can become a flammable material itself. If the flame is not burning cleanly, it can lick the sides of the flue or ignition components, potentially igniting nearby combustible materials. Cracked or Damaged Flue: The flue is designed to safely vent the exhaust gases from the propane burner out of the RV. If this flue becomes cracked, warped, or otherwise damaged, hot exhaust gases can escape into the refrigerator's chassis and surrounding areas. These gases are incredibly hot and can easily ignite insulation, wiring, or any other flammable materials present. Burner Obstructions: Small insects, debris, or even rust can obstruct the burner orifice. This can cause an uneven flame, improper ignition, or even a delayed ignition, where propane accumulates before igniting, creating a small explosion or a larger, uncontrolled flame. Faulty Igniter: While less directly a fire starter, a malfunctioning igniter can lead to repeated attempts to light the burner, potentially allowing excess propane to leak into the area before ignition, creating a risk. Gas Leaks: Although not exclusive to the refrigerator, any leak in the propane system feeding the refrigerator can lead to dangerous situations. If a leak occurs near the burner assembly, it can ignite unexpectedly. 2. Electrical System IssuesWhile most RV refrigerators have a propane option, many also have an electric heating element for use when hooked up to shore power or a generator. Electrical problems can also contribute to fires:
Short Circuits: Damaged or frayed wiring, loose connections, or faulty components within the refrigerator's electrical system can cause short circuits. These shorts can generate excessive heat, arc, and potentially ignite nearby flammable materials like dust, insulation, or wiring insulation itself. Overheating Heating Elements: Like any heating element, the one in your RV refrigerator can fail. If it overheats or malfunctions, it can reach temperatures high enough to ignite surrounding materials. This is particularly concerning if the element is not properly shielded or if debris has accumulated around it. Faulty Control Boards: The electronic control board manages the operation of the refrigerator. A malfunction in this board could lead to incorrect power distribution, overheating components, or failure to shut off heating elements when they should, all of which can be fire hazards. 3. Poor Ventilation and OverheatingAbsorption refrigerators need adequate airflow to dissipate heat. This is a critical aspect of their operation and a frequent oversight for RV owners.
Blocked Air Vents: RV refrigerators have vents, typically on the exterior of the RV, that allow air to circulate around the coils and the burner assembly. If these vents are blocked by debris, vegetation, storage items, or even improperly installed awnings, the refrigerator cannot dissipate heat effectively. This leads to overheating of the entire unit. Overcrowding in the Refrigerator Compartment: While not directly causing a fire, poor airflow *around* the refrigerator unit itself can exacerbate overheating issues. If items are stored too close to the back of the refrigerator where the heat exchange occurs, it can contribute to elevated temperatures. External Heat Sources: Parking your RV in direct, intense sunlight during extremely hot weather can also contribute to the refrigerator working harder and potentially overheating, especially if ventilation is already compromised. 4. Accumulation of Combustible MaterialsThe area around an RV refrigerator, particularly the back where the burner and cooling unit are located, can become a breeding ground for flammable materials.
Dust and Lint Buildup: Over time, dust, lint, and other airborne particles can accumulate on and around the burner assembly and flue. This fine material is highly combustible and can be easily ignited by a stray spark or excessive heat. Insect Nests: Spiders, wasps, and other insects often build nests in the warm, protected areas around the refrigerator's burner and flue. These nests, made of organic materials like mud, silk, and plant matter, are highly flammable. Improper Storage: Storing flammable items like cleaning supplies, rags, or even paper products near the refrigerator compartment, especially on the exterior where the vents are located, is a significant fire hazard. 5. Improper Installation or ModificationsWhen an RV refrigerator is not installed correctly, or if modifications are made without proper knowledge, it can create dangerous situations.
Loose Gas Lines: If the propane lines are not securely connected, they can leak, leading to the risk of ignition. Incorrect Venting: Improperly installed or sealed flues can allow exhaust gases to enter the RV instead of being safely vented outside. Electrical Wiring Errors: Incorrect wiring during installation or after repairs can lead to shorts and overheating. 6. Age and Wear and TearLike any appliance, RV refrigerators age. Components can degrade over time, increasing the risk of malfunction.
Corrosion: In the damp environment of an RV, components can corrode. This is particularly true for the burner assembly and flue, where corrosion can lead to leaks or structural weaknesses that compromise safety. Deterioration of Seals and Insulation: The seals around the refrigerator door can degrade, causing the unit to work harder. More critically, the insulation within and around the refrigerator compartment can break down, potentially exposing heat sources to flammable materials.Unique Considerations for RV Refrigerators
It’s important to acknowledge that RV refrigerators operate under very different conditions than their household counterparts, which significantly influences why do RV refrigerators catch fire.
Movement and Vibration: RVs are constantly on the move, subject to bumps, vibrations, and jarring. This movement can loosen connections, stress components, and potentially cause cracks in the burner or flue over time. Varying Environmental Conditions: RVs travel through diverse climates, from extreme heat to cold. The refrigerator must perform reliably in all these conditions, often working harder in hot weather or at higher altitudes, which can strain the system. Limited Space and Access: The confined spaces within an RV mean that the refrigerator's components are often packed tightly. This makes proper ventilation even more critical and can make inspection and maintenance more challenging, potentially allowing small issues to go unnoticed. Reliance on Propane: The ability to run on propane is a major convenience, but it also introduces the inherent risks associated with storing and using flammable gas.Preventative Maintenance: Your First Line of Defense
The most effective way to combat the risks associated with why do RV refrigerators catch fire is through diligent preventative maintenance. Think of it as an investment in your safety and the longevity of your RV.
Regular Inspections: A Checklist for RV OwnersSchedule regular inspections of your RV refrigerator, ideally at least once a year, or more frequently if you are a heavy user. Here’s a detailed checklist:
Exterior Vent Inspection: Ensure the exterior vents (usually on the side or back of the RV) are completely clear of any debris, leaves, nests, or obstructions. Check for any damage to the vent covers themselves. Action: Clean thoroughly with a brush and vacuum. If damaged, repair or replace. Burner Assembly and Flue Cleaning: This is a critical step for propane operation. Access the burner assembly and flue, usually found behind an exterior access panel. Inspect the burner for any signs of corrosion, damage, or obstruction. Carefully inspect the flue for any cracks, warping, or soot buildup. Action: Gently clean the burner and flue with a soft brush or compressed air. For significant soot buildup, a specialized flue brush may be necessary. If you find any cracks or significant damage to the flue, do NOT use the propane mode until it is repaired or replaced by a qualified technician. Igniter Check: Ensure the igniter is sparking reliably when the burner is attempting to light. Check for any debris or corrosion on the igniter tip. Action: Clean the igniter tip gently. If it’s not sparking consistently, it may need adjustment or replacement. Gas Line and Connection Inspection: Visually inspect the propane lines leading to the refrigerator for any signs of wear, cracking, or kinking. Check all connections for tightness. Action: Use a soapy water solution to check for leaks. Apply the solution to all fittings and connections; if bubbles appear, there is a leak. If you suspect a leak, turn off the propane supply immediately and have it professionally repaired. Electrical Connections: While less exposed, if you have access to the electrical components, visually inspect wiring for any signs of fraying, scorching, or loose connections. Action: If you see any concerning issues, it's best to have a qualified RV technician inspect and repair them. Leveling: Absorption refrigerators must be level to operate correctly. An unlevel refrigerator can cause the ammonia solution to pool, leading to inefficient cooling and potential damage to the cooling unit, which could indirectly contribute to issues. Action: Ensure your RV is level before operating the refrigerator, especially when on propane. Use leveling blocks and your RV's leveling system. Cleanliness Around the Unit: Periodically, access the area behind the refrigerator (if possible and safe to do so) and clean out any accumulated dust, lint, or debris. Action: Use a vacuum with a brush attachment. Be cautious of electrical components. Professional Servicing: When to Call the ExpertsWhile DIY maintenance is valuable, some tasks are best left to the professionals. You should consider having your RV refrigerator professionally serviced:
Annually or Bi-Annually: Especially if you use your RV frequently. If You Notice Performance Issues: Such as reduced cooling, strange noises, or unusual smells. After Any Suspected Gas Leak or Electrical Problem. Before Extended Storage: To ensure it's in good working order.A qualified RV technician can perform more in-depth checks, including testing the burner efficiency, checking refrigerant levels (though these are sealed systems, a technician can identify issues), and diagnosing electrical faults.
Safe Operating Practices: Beyond Maintenance
Beyond regular maintenance, adopting safe operating practices can further mitigate the risks associated with why do RV refrigerators catch fire.
Always Ensure Proper Ventilation: Never block the exterior vents. When parking, be mindful of your surroundings and avoid parking in areas where vegetation could easily be drawn into the vents. Use Propane Safely: Ensure your propane tanks are in good condition and properly connected. Never use the refrigerator's propane mode if you suspect a gas leak. Turn off the propane supply to the refrigerator when it's not in use for extended periods or when performing maintenance on the propane system. Monitor for Odors: A burning smell or a strong ammonia smell (distinct from the faint, specific odor of propane) can indicate a problem. If you detect any unusual smells, turn off the appliance immediately and investigate. Avoid Storing Flammable Materials Nearby: This cannot be stressed enough. Keep cleaning supplies, aerosols, and other flammable items away from the refrigerator compartment, both inside and outside the RV. Check for Ice Buildup: Excessive ice buildup inside the freezer compartment can sometimes indicate an issue with the seals or the cooling unit's performance, potentially leading to increased strain on the system. Listen for Unusual Noises: While absorption refrigerators can make some gurgling or humming sounds as part of their normal operation, any new or alarming noises should be investigated. Never Operate a Damaged Unit: If you notice any physical damage to the refrigerator, its components, or its housing, do not operate it until it has been inspected and repaired.Fire Safety Measures: Be Prepared
Despite your best efforts, accidents can happen. It's essential to have fire safety measures in place:
Install Smoke and Carbon Monoxide Detectors: Ensure you have working smoke detectors and carbon monoxide detectors installed in your RV, and test them regularly. The refrigerator, especially when running on propane, produces carbon monoxide. Keep a Fire Extinguisher Handy: Have a multi-purpose (Class ABC) fire extinguisher readily accessible in your RV, and know how to use it. A small fire extinguisher specifically for kitchen fires (Class K) could also be beneficial. Know Your RV's Shut-Off Valves: Be familiar with the location of your main propane shut-off valve and individual appliance shut-off valves. In an emergency, you need to be able to quickly stop the fuel supply. Develop an Escape Plan: Like any home, have a plan for how everyone in the RV will exit safely in case of a fire.Frequently Asked Questions About RV Refrigerator Fires
Q1: Why does my RV refrigerator smell like ammonia when it's not supposed to?An ammonia smell is a serious indicator that there may be a leak in the refrigerator's sealed cooling system. This system uses an ammonia-based solution. If you detect a strong ammonia odor, it means this solution is escaping. This is not only a fire risk but also a health hazard. Ammonia is a corrosive gas and can cause respiratory irritation and damage to eyes and skin. In such a scenario, you should immediately turn off the refrigerator, ventilate the RV thoroughly, and refrain from using the appliance until it has been professionally inspected and repaired. Do not attempt to repair a leak in the cooling unit yourself; it requires specialized knowledge and equipment.
Q2: How often should I have my RV refrigerator professionally inspected?For most RV owners, a professional inspection of the refrigerator annually or bi-annually is recommended, especially if you use your RV frequently throughout the year. If you are a seasonal user, an inspection before the start of each camping season is a wise practice. Additionally, consider a professional check if you notice any decline in performance, unusual noises, or if the RV has been in storage for an extended period. Regular professional servicing can catch potential issues before they escalate into major problems, including fire hazards.
Q3: Can I run my RV refrigerator on electricity all the time to avoid propane risks?While running your RV refrigerator on electricity (either from shore power or a generator) eliminates the immediate risks associated with propane ignition, it doesn't eliminate all fire risks. As discussed, electrical malfunctions, overheating heating elements, or short circuits can still cause fires. Furthermore, absorption refrigerators are designed to be more energy-efficient on propane, especially for off-grid boondocking. If you primarily camp at established campgrounds with electrical hookups, using the electric mode is a viable option to reduce propane-related risks. However, it’s crucial to remember that even the electric mode requires proper maintenance and awareness of potential electrical faults.
Q4: What should I do if I suspect my RV refrigerator is overheating?If you suspect your RV refrigerator is overheating, the first and most critical step is to turn it off. If it's running on propane, shut off the propane supply to the refrigerator at the appliance itself, or at the main propane tank if you cannot safely access the appliance's shut-off. If it's running on electricity, unplug it from the power source or turn off the breaker for the refrigerator. Once it's off and cooled down, inspect the exterior vents for any blockages and ensure there is adequate airflow around the unit. If the overheating persists after clearing any obstructions, or if you are unsure of the cause, it’s essential to have the unit inspected by a qualified RV technician. Overheating can lead to component failure and significantly increase the risk of fire.
Q5: Are RV refrigerators from certain brands more prone to catching fire?While specific brands might have their own common issues, the fundamental principles of absorption refrigeration and the common failure points (burner assembly, flue, ventilation, electrical components) are consistent across most major RV refrigerator manufacturers. The risks are generally tied more to the operational principles and maintenance rather than a specific brand being inherently more dangerous. However, some models might have design elements that make them more or less susceptible to certain issues. It's always wise to research reviews and common maintenance tips for the specific make and model of your RV refrigerator.
Q6: My RV refrigerator is making a strange "popping" or "whooshing" sound when igniting the propane. Is this normal?A slight "whoosh" sound is often normal when the propane igniter sparks and the burner ignites. However, a loud "popping" or "backfire" sound can indicate an issue. This often suggests that propane is accumulating in the burner tube or flue before igniting, which can lead to an inefficient burn or even a small explosion. This can happen due to obstructions in the burner or flue, improper gas pressure, or a faulty igniter. If you hear this, it's a strong signal that the burner system needs to be inspected. Continued operation with this kind of sound can increase the risk of damaging the flue or igniting accumulated debris, thereby increasing the fire risk. It's best to have it checked by a professional technician.
Q7: What is the biggest single risk factor for RV refrigerator fires?Based on incident reports and technician experiences, the biggest single risk factor is generally considered to be the combination of soot buildup in the flue and burner assembly coupled with inadequate ventilation. When soot restricts the exhaust and flammable debris accumulates around the hot components, and the unit cannot dissipate heat effectively, it creates a prime environment for a fire to start. These issues are often a result of infrequent maintenance and overlooked external vent blockages.
Q8: Can a faulty thermostat cause my RV refrigerator to catch fire?While a faulty thermostat itself may not directly *cause* a fire by igniting something, it can contribute to hazardous conditions. If a thermostat malfunctions and fails to regulate the temperature properly, it can cause the heating element (either propane or electric) to run continuously or at an excessively high setting. This prolonged, uncontrolled heating can lead to overheating of the entire unit and its surroundings, potentially igniting nearby flammable materials. Therefore, while not the ignition source itself, a malfunctioning thermostat can be a critical contributing factor to a fire scenario by allowing the system to operate outside safe parameters.
Q9: How do I know if my RV refrigerator needs to be replaced due to safety concerns?Several indicators suggest it might be time to consider replacing your RV refrigerator for safety reasons. These include: persistent and unfixable leaks (ammonia or refrigerant), significant rust or corrosion on the burner assembly or flue, visible cracks in the flue, evidence of electrical shorts or scorching on wiring, repeated malfunctions despite professional repairs, or if the unit is simply very old and components are showing significant wear. If your refrigerator is consistently failing to cool effectively, working much harder than it should, or if you’ve had multiple instances of minor issues that point to an aging and unreliable system, it’s prudent to consult with an RV appliance specialist about replacement. The cost of a new refrigerator is far less than the potential cost of a fire.
